A mutation testing framework for Ruby, powered by a Rust core for fast AST-level mutations. Mutagen modifies your source code in small ways (mutations) and runs your tests against each change to find weaknesses in your test suite.
- Rust-powered mutation engine -- parses Ruby via lib-ruby-parser, generates mutations at the AST level, and applies them via byte-range replacement
- 5 mutation operators -- arithmetic, comparison, boolean, conditional, literal
- Coverage-guided filtering -- skip mutations on lines not covered by your tests (via SimpleCov)
- Incremental caching -- skip unchanged mutations on repeat runs
- Parallel execution -- fork-based worker pool with configurable concurrency
- CI sharding -- split mutations across CI jobs with
--shard N/TOTAL - Flexible test runners -- RSpec and Minitest adapters

bundle exec rake compilemutagen runThis will:
- Find Ruby files matching your configured include patterns
- Generate mutations using all enabled operators
- Filter by coverage data (if available)
- Execute each mutation against your test suite in parallel
- Report which mutations survived (indicating test gaps)
mutagen run [options]
--since REF Only mutate code changed since git ref
--sample AMOUNT Sample mutations (e.g. "25%" or "500")
--shard N/TOTAL Run shard N of TOTAL (e.g. "1/4")
--operator OP Run single operator (e.g. "arithmetic")
--jobs, -j N Number of parallel workers
--fail-under N Minimum mutation score (default: 80)
--test-runner NAME Test runner: rspec or minitest
--no-coverage Disable coverage-based filtering
--no-incremental Disable incremental caching

fail_under: 80 # Exit non-zero if mutation score is below this| Category | Mutations |
|---|---|
| Arithmetic | + <-> -, * <-> /, % -> * |
| Comparison | > <-> >=, < <-> <=, > <-> <, >= <-> <=, == <-> != |
| Boolean | && <-> ||, true <-> false |
| Conditional | if cond -> if true / if false, remove else branch |
| Literal | 0 <-> 1, N -> 0, "" <-> "mutagen", [] -> [nil] |
